Which energy storage technologies are being commissioned in Finland?

Currently, utility-scale energy storage technologies that have been commissioned in Finland are limited to BESS (lithium-ion batteries) and TES, mainly TTES and Cavern Thermal Energy Storages (CTES) connected to DH systems.

What is the future of energy storage in Finland?

Reserve markets are currently driving the demand for energy storage systems. Legislative changes have improved prospects for some energy storages. Mainly battery storage and thermal energy storages have been deployed so far. The share of renewable energy sources is growing rapidly in Finland.

Is energy storage legal in Finland?

Like the energy storage market, legislation related to energy storage is still developing in Finland. The two are intertwined as who is allowed to own and operate energy storages will define the business models of the storages. A major barrier to the implementation of ESS was removed when the issue of double taxation was solved.
